Core SEO Product Content Methods

Keyword Research with Data

When conducting keyword research, focus on terms with clear commercial intent. Words like "buy" or "online" signal transactional intent, which often leads to higher conversions. For example, phrases like "buy organic cotton bedsheets online" boast a 4.1% conversion rate compared to 1.3% for informational keywords [6]. AI tools can help pinpoint long-tail keywords that convert up to three times better than generic ones [3][6].

To choose the best keywords, aim for these metrics:

  • Commercial relevance: Above 60%
  • Monthly search volume: Between 500–5,000
  • Keyword difficulty: Below 35
  • Conversion rates: Over 2.8%

These targeted keywords lay the groundwork for building effective topic clusters.

Fixing Keyword Conflicts

Keyword cannibalization is a common issue for e-commerce sites. To address this, focus on content audits and URL consolidation, using tools mentioned earlier.

1. Content Gap Analysis

Identify pages targeting overlapping keywords and competing for the same search intent [12].

2. Strategic Consolidation

Use canonical tags to signal search engines which page should be prioritized when multiple pages target similar terms.

3. Content Differentiation

Develop unique angles for similar products by emphasizing distinct use cases or features. This approach has led to a 43% improvement in rankings for previously conflicting pages [6].

SEO Performance Tracking

Organic Traffic Metrics

Once you've rolled out AI-driven keyword strategies, keep a close eye on these metrics to measure success:

Metric Target Range Why It Matters
Click-through Rate (CTR) Over 3.5% for commercial terms Higher CTR often means better conversion opportunities.
Organic Sessions Growth 15-20% month-over-month (MoM) Shows how well your content is driving traffic.
Featured Snippet Rate More than 8% of eligible queries Boosts your authority on specific topics.
Conversion Rate by Keyword Above 2% for purchase-intent terms Ties directly to revenue performance.
